Fostering Creativity in Development Teams: Unleashing Innovation for Success

In the dynamic landscape of software development, creativity acts as a catalyst for innovation. This article explores strategies and practices essential for nurturing creativity within development teams. From cultivating a conducive environment to implementing tools and techniques, we delve into the fundamental aspects of fostering creativity in software development.

Table of Contents:

Understanding the Value of Creativity in Development

Creativity is a driving force behind innovation in software development. It leads to unique solutions, improved user experiences, and competitive advantages. Recognizing its value is the first step in fostering creativity.

Building a Creative Work Environment

Creating an environment that encourages creativity is essential. This involves open communication, flexible workspaces, and a culture that values experimentation and risk-taking. It's important to establish psychological safety where team members feel comfortable sharing ideas without fear of criticism.

Encouraging Collaboration and Diverse Perspectives

Collaboration and diverse perspectives fuel creativity. Encourage cross-functional teams and seek input from individuals with varied backgrounds and experiences. Diversity fosters a wider range of ideas and solutions.

Providing Time and Space for Creative Thinking

Devote time for creative thinking and exploration. Encourage team members to step away from their regular tasks and engage in activities that stimulate creativity, such as brainstorming sessions, hackathons, or design sprints.

Incorporating Agile and Design Thinking Methodologies

Agile and design thinking methodologies promote creativity by emphasizing iterative development and user-centric design. These approaches encourage teams to continuously refine their work based on feedback and evolving requirements.

Leveraging Creativity-Boosting Tools and Software

There are various software tools that can aid creativity in development. Tools for mind mapping, prototyping, and collaborative whiteboarding can facilitate idea generation and visualization. Platforms like Trello and Jira can help organize and prioritize creative projects.

Celebrating and Recognizing Creative Achievements

Acknowledge and celebrate creative achievements within the team. Recognition can be in the form of awards, promotions, or simply public appreciation. Celebrating creativity reinforces its value and encourages team members to continue innovating.

Real-World Examples of Creative Development Teams

Examining real-world examples of creative development teams, such as those behind innovative products like the iPhone or groundbreaking software like Adobe Photoshop, can inspire and provide insights into nurturing creativity.

Measuring and Improving Creativity

Measuring creativity can be challenging, but it's essential to assess its impact on development projects. Surveys, feedback mechanisms, and tracking innovative solutions can help evaluate and improve creativity within the team.

Creativity is a cornerstone of innovation in development teams. By fostering a creative culture, providing the right environment, encouraging collaboration, and leveraging tools and methodologies, organizations can unleash the full potential of their development teams and drive success through innovation.

